University of Strathclyde Founded in 1796 –‘Place of Useful Learning’ –Innovative Teaching –Focus on Employability Located in the heart of Glasgow –Easy access to all transport link and great for shopping and entertainment Student population of over 20,000 students with approximately 15,000 studying for their first degree

www.glasgow.ac.uk/dumfries @dumfriescampus glasgowdumfries University of Glasgow Fourth oldest university in the UK Russell Group Dumfries Campus Smaller, specialist campus Very welcoming; easy to settle in Work placements on ALL programmes Lots of practical study: field trips, guest lectures, workshop groups, teaching garden… Small classes and friendly lecturers Cosmopolitan student community, roughly: 50% Scottish, 25% rest of UK, 25% EU/international

Financing your studies The Scottish Government ordinarily pays your tuition fees for you if you’re a Scottish or EU resident Student loans and bursaries available (personal circumstances determine amounts) One application form to complete each year of study! (April before study begins) For detailed information: www.saas.gov.uk Scottish Universities Tour 2014
